通过Scratch编程实现创意项目的灵活性与乐趣

频道:下载中心 日期: 浏览:34

在当今科技飞速发展的时代,编程已经成为一种必备的技能,而Scratch作为一种面向儿童和初学者的编程语言,以其简洁直观的图形化界面吸引了众多年轻用户。Scratch不仅是学习编程的工具,更是培养创造力和逻辑思维能力的平台。通过Scratch编程,孩子们能够实现他们的创意项目,享受到编程的灵活性和乐趣。

Scratch的设计理念强调“学习通过创造”,这使得用户在编程的过程中可以充分发挥他们的想象力和创造力。使用Scratch,用户可以通过简单的拖拽方式,将不同的代码块组合在一起,创建出丰富多样的动画、游戏和互动故事。这种方式不仅降低了编程的门槛,也让编程变得更加有趣。孩子们可以根据自己的兴趣和想法,自由地设计角色和场景,编写故事情节,甚至可以通过编程实现音乐的创作,从而使他们的项目更加生动和个性化。

通过Scratch编程实现创意项目的灵活性与乐趣

Scratch的灵活性体现在它对项目的多样化支持上。用户可以创建各种类型的项目,包括小型游戏、互动艺术作品、教育工具等。通过Scratch,孩子们不仅能够学习基本的编程概念,例如循环、条件判断和变量等,还可以将这些概念应用于实际项目中。例如,一个孩子可以设计一个简单的迷宫游戏,利用条件判断来控制角色的移动,并通过变量记录分数。这种实践性的学习方式,让他们能够更深入地理解编程的逻辑和原理。

此外,Scratch的社区功能也为用户提供了一个交流和分享的平台。孩子们可以将自己的项目上传到Scratch社区,与全球的用户分享,获取反馈和建议。同时,他们也可以浏览其他用户的作品,从中获得灵感。这种互动不仅增强了学习的乐趣,也培养了他们的合作精神和开放思维。通过参与社区,孩子们能够看到不同的创意和解决方案,这不仅拓宽了他们的视野,也激励他们不断尝试新的想法和技术。

总的来说,Scratch编程不仅是学习语言和技能的过程,更是一个充满探索与发现的旅程。通过Scratch,孩子们可以在实践中学习,享受创造的乐趣,培养解决问题的能力。在这个过程中,他们不仅收获了编程知识,更获得了自信和成就感。无论是设计一个简单的动画,还是创造一个复杂的游戏,Scratch都为孩子们提供了一个广阔的舞台,让他们自由发挥自己的想象力,尽情享受编程带来的乐趣与挑战。